For a given form factor and type, are there high quality/performqnce and low quality/perfermance brands in the MOSFET world?
Nelson Pass commented in one of his Zen articles that people send him super-duper caps, wire, resistors, etc., but what he really would prefer (and never receives) is a better MOSFET. Was this a rhetorical statement by Mr. Pass? Are there no "Ferrari" MOSFETs on the market? He speaks about non-linear input capacitance being the source of distortion. Do all MOSFETs suffer from this characteristic, even the "Ferraris", if they exist?

It depends on the part. Charles Hansen would steer you
away from IR brand P channel parts, and for Common Source applications, so would I, recommending Harris or Fairchild. On the N channel parts, there is no standout in the IR types - IR seems to have a little more part-to-part consistency in my experience, but not enough to drive the choice if you're already testing them. Of course we're only talking about vertical Mosfets when we talk about IR, and lateral Mosfets are a different breed. Some prefer them as they seem to have more linear capacitance, but often this is more than offset by the very much lower transconductance. All you can do is try this stuff out and see how well it works in a particular application.
